Karbon-X Corp. operates as a vertically integrated climate solutions company serving compliance and voluntary carbon markets. Company updates center on carbon-credit trading, structured procurement, emissions quantification, verification support, credit issuance and market distribution for businesses and institutions.
Recurring KARX news includes Canadian compliance activity tied to Alberta TIER, the federal Output-Based Pricing System and British Columbia OBPS; development of carbon projects such as the Sur del Meta REDD+ project in Colombia; and digital tools including the Corporate Emissions Calculator and SkyXero flight-emissions app. Coverage also includes enterprise climate-platform partnerships, MRV and biodiversity data integration, carbon-credit portfolio activity and periodic financial reporting tied to the company's growth in global carbon markets.
Karbon-X Corp (OTCQB:KARX) announced the acquisition of an 80% interest in Silviculture Systems Corp on November 15, 2022. This strategic move aims to enhance reforestation efforts in the Chiquitania Region, targeting the planting of over 5 million Baru Nut Trees in the coming years. The acquisition will support local operations in Bolivia and create a bio-char production stream from waste materials. The projects are currently under review for carbon offset verification, which will enable Karbon-X to offer carbon offsets through its mobile app.
Karbon-X Corp. (OTC PINK:KARX) has announced the upcoming launch of its user-friendly mobile app aimed at facilitating carbon offsetting. The app allows users to create profiles, select CO2-reducing projects, and share their commitment to climate action via social media. It also provides options for gifting carbon offsets and enables small businesses to support their employees' carbon footprint. Anticipated beta testing will begin by the end of 2022, with an official launch expected in Q1 2023, potentially boosting investments in underfunded environmental projects.
Karbon-X Corp (OTC PINK:KARX) has launched a BioCarbon Registry account to register carbon credit projects related to the planting of Dipteryx Alata Baru Nut trees and a sustainable charcoal initiative in Bolivia. This partnership with SCS and 4everforest marks a significant step toward carbon credit verification through a secure blockchain platform. Additionally, KARX plans to co-develop methodologies for alternative crop planting, such as hemp, aimed at CO2 sequestration.
Karbon-X Corp (OTC:KARX) announced a partnership with Heimdal CCU to develop carbon capture units that will permanently remove atmospheric CO2. Each unit aims to capture 1,000-5,000 tonnes of CO2 over 20 years while generating carbon credits. Karbon-X will receive 50% of these credits. Heimdal CCU plans to expand operations significantly by 2025, reaching a capacity of 5MT/year. This collaboration is expected to enhance both companies' growth and contribute to visible CO2 reduction efforts in response to climate change challenges.
